📚

Adult Learning Theories

Why This Matters:

Refreshing your knowledge on adult learning principles will help you tailor your teaching strategies to meet the needs of adult learners, enhancing engagement and retention.

Recommended Resource:

"The Adult Learner: The Definitive Classic in Adult Education and Human Resource Development" by Malcolm S. Knowles - This book offers foundational insights into adult learning theories.

📚

Curriculum Development Models

Why This Matters:

Reviewing curriculum development models will provide you with frameworks to structure your training programs effectively, ensuring they meet industry standards and learner needs.

Recommended Resource:

"Understanding by Design" by Grant Wiggins and Jay McTighe - This resource focuses on backward design principles that are essential for effective curriculum development.

📚

Assessment Strategies

Why This Matters:

Refreshing your knowledge of assessment techniques will ensure you can create meaningful evaluations that align with learning outcomes and provide constructive feedback.

Recommended Resource:

"Classroom Assessment Techniques: A Handbook for College Teachers" by Thomas A. Angelo and K. Patricia Cross - This handbook offers practical assessment strategies applicable to various learning environments.
